Never Say Sorry Again




Everybody makes mistakes sometimes. When it happens we need a phrase to tell the other person how really sorry we are and stop them getting really angry. Here are ten phrases.


Ten Expressions to Use


  1. Sorry.

  2. I'm (so / very / terribly) sorry.

  3. Ever so sorry.

  4. How stupid / careless / thoughtless of me.

  5. Pardon (me).

  6. That's my fault.

  7. Sorry. It was all my fault.

  8. Please excuse my (ignorance).

  9. Please don't be mad at me.

  10. Please accept our (sincerest) apologies.




How To Use These Phrases


Sorry.

'Sorry' is a general short apology. We use this when we bump into people on the street. At other times, it sounds too weak.


I'm (so / very / terribly) sorry.

We use 'so', 'very' and 'terribly' to make the meaning stronger. 'Terribly' is the strongest. If we use one of the words in brackets, it is stressed.


Ever so sorry.

“Ever so sorry” is quite formal but it's a stronger apology than just 'sorry'.


How stupid / careless / thoughtless of me.

Used to criticize ourselves and the mistake that we have just made.
